在 neo4j 上查询关系 1:m - graphql

query in relation 1:m on neo4j - graphql

我刚开始使用 neo4j,我有一个节点与其他 2 个节点有类型 'TYPE_OF' 的关系,当我执行以下查询时:match(e:Event)-[:TYPE_OF]->(t:Tag) where e.type="ACL.SINGUP" and e.subtype="Birth" return e,t returns预期结果result

然而,当我 运行 来自 graphql 的相同查询时,我只从关系中获得一个节点而不是两个。这是 graphql 中的查询:call graphql.query("{Event(type:\"ACL.SINGUP\", subtype:\"Birth\"){_id,data,typeOf {_id,owner,name}}}") graphql result

typeOf graphql 模式定义中的集合类型吗?

e.g.
`type Event {
 _id: ID,
 data: String,
 typeOf: [TypeOf] 
}
type TypeOf {
 _id: ID,
 owner: String,
 name: String
}`